Can you Dryfire airsoft gun?
Dryfiring is when you fire a weapon without any ammunition in it. While dryfiring an airsoft weapon won’t cause any immediate damage, it can speed up the wear and tear of the internal components. Therefore, it’s best to avoid dryfiring as much as possible to prolong the life of your weapon.

What countries is airsoft illegal
Airsoft is a sports where participants eliminate opponents by shooting spherical plastic pellets from replica firearms. Airsoft is considered illegal in various countries such as Korea, Malaysia, Thailand, and Singapore, and some countries like Canada prohibit the importation of “replica” Airsoft guns.

How far can airsoft guns shoot
With gas-powered airsoft pistols, you can expect a maximum effective range of 50-80 feet (15m-24m), on average. Spring-powered airsoft pistols, meanwhile, do a little worse, offering a max effective range of only 40ft (12m).
